Friday, February 17th, HPHS's National Honor Society is sponsoring our second Parents' Night Out event. This event will raise funds to enable our NHS chapter to participate in new projects and sponsor other events for the community in the future.
Parents Night Out will take place in the 1st-floor wing of Hancock Place High School (229 W. Ripa Ave). Drop-off and Pick-up will take in the teacher's lot off Clyde Rd at the back of the High School building. You will see signs on the doors and a registration table.
The cost for the event is $20, which will cover four hours of babysitting for up to two children If you have more than two children, we will charge an additional $5 for each child. Drop-Off for children will begin at 5:00 PM and parents can pick up their children any time before 9:00 PM.
The event is available for any children in Pre-K-5th grade. All kiddos must be potty trained. Kiddos will be grouped by age and take turns in many activities including making crafts, playing games, a music/dance party, cookie decorating and making waffles for a breakfast-for-dinner.
Each room will be staffed by three NHS student volunteers (the NHS members have been CPR certified as an added safety measure.
